snake-as |
23-05-2008 05:02 808900 |
Групповая смена пароля администратора (рабочие станции - XP)
Здравствуйте. Подскажите, пожалуйста, какую-нибудь утилиту для смены пароля администратора на нескольких компьютерах. Компьютеры, конечно, в домене, я являюсь Домен админом. Заранее спасибо..
|
Delirium |
23-05-2008 07:40 808927 |
в смысле смены пароля? Мой компьютер - управление - подключиться к другому компу - выбираешь комп- выбираешь пользователя - меняешь пароль. все.
|
snake-as |
23-05-2008 07:53 808933 |
Я имею в виду, когда у меня много машин (до 200), не буду же я на каждую заходить.
|
sacredboy |
23-05-2008 08:27 808948 |
snake-as попробуй этой прогой.
P.S. FTP доступен не кргулосуточно.
|
snake-as |
23-05-2008 08:46 808953 |
sacredboy, ссылка не работает. Можете дать рабочую. Я просто натыкался уже на такую же тему, там эту же программу советовали, я тоже не смог зайти.
Извините, не прочитал, что не круглосуточно:)
|
Maximus_MF |
23-05-2008 09:36 808987 |
|
Dimas_83 |
23-05-2008 09:41 808993 |
Попробуйте воспользоваться консольной утилитой pspasswd.exe из набора PsTools.
|
monkkey |
26-05-2008 07:52 810788 |
|
artem_ |
26-05-2008 12:18 810934 |
Можно вот так попробовать
Код:
Option Explicit
Dim objComputer ' Экземпляр объекта Computer
Dim objUser ' Экземпляр объекта User
Dim strComputer ' Имя компьютера
Dim strUser ' Имя создаваемого пользователя
Dim strpass ' пароль пользователя
Dim objSysInfo 'массив для хранения свойств компьютера, считанных из AD
Dim arrFULLNAME 'служебный массив
Dim arrCN 'служебный массив
Set objSysInfo = CreateObject("ADSystemInfo")
strComputer = objSysInfo.ComputerName
arrFULLNAME = Split(strComputer, ",")
arrCN = Split(arrFULLNAME(0), "=")
strComputer=arrCN(1)
strUser = "admin"
strpass = "654321"
Set objUser = GetObject("WinNT://" & strComputer & "/" & strUser)
objUser.Description = "Пароль изменен при помощи скрипта"
objUser.SetPassword strpass
objUser.SetInfo
|
Время: 08:24.
© OSzone.net 2001-